How to invite team members and control project access
Published · Last updated
Organization Owners and Admins send invitations from Organization Settings → Invitations. Choose Admin for access to every project, or Member for access limited to projects assigned through teams.
If you start from a connected AI assistant, use get_current_scope to confirm the authorized organization, then complete the invitation in Agiflow. MCP does not manage human invitations, roles, or team access.
At a glance
Invite the person, assign a team if they are a Member, then verify their role and project access after they accept. Owner status is managed separately and cannot be selected during invitation.
Invite a person in Agiflow
Send the invitation from Organization Settings, then use a team to control which projects a Member can open.
Prerequisites
- You are signed in as an organization Owner or Admin.
- You know whether the person needs Admin access or Member access through selected teams.
- If you want to assign a team during invitation, create the team first.
Send the invitation
- Open Organization Settings → Invitations.
- Select Invite Member, or Invite Your First Member when no invitation exists.
- Enter the person's Email Address.
- Choose Admin or Member under Role.
- Select an optional team when the person should inherit that team's project access.
- Select Send Invitation.

Set project access with teams
Admins and Owners can access every project. A Member can access only projects assigned to their teams. To change a Member's access, open Organization Settings → Teams, choose Members for the team, add the person, then use Assign under Team Projects to select each required project.

Expected result
Before acceptance, the invitation appears under Pending Invitations. After acceptance, the person appears under Members with the selected role. Members can open team-assigned projects, while Admins can open every project.

Verify access
- Confirm the invitation appears under Pending Invitations.
- After acceptance, confirm the person's name, email, and role under Members.
- For a Member, confirm their team membership and assigned projects under Teams.

Limitations and recovery
- If email is delayed, copy the invitation link from Pending Invitations and send it directly.
- If the address or role is wrong, cancel the pending invitation and send a new one.
- If a Member cannot open a project, verify that their team includes that project.
- Change an accepted person's role under Members. Owner status is managed separately.
